Switching Contexts: Expansion & Compaction

A simple example

ex <- 
 '{ 
      "date": "1993-10-02",
      "site": "N654",
      "scientificName": "Picea rubens",
      "area": 2,
      "count": 26
 }'

No need to alter your own data files/source data files. Simply define a context that maps those terms into the reference vocabulary. Data can use whatever fields it likes.

map <- 
'{ 
  "@context": {
    "@vocab": "http://example.com/",
    "scientificName": "http://example.com/species"
  }
}'
target <- '{"@context": {"@vocab": "http://example.com/"}}'
add_context(ex, map) %>% 
  jsonld_compact(target)
## {
##   "@context": {
##     "@vocab": "http://example.com/"
##   },
##   "area": 2,
##   "count": 26,
##   "date": "1993-10-02",
##   "site": "N654",
##   "species": "Picea rubens"
## }

Integration: Flattening shares id

context <- '{   "@context": { "@vocab": "http://example.com/" } }'

ex <- '{
  "@context": { "@vocab": "http://example.com/" },
  "datasets": [
    {
      "@id": "http://global_unique_id",
      "@type": "dataset",
      "image": "http://image_uri",
      "name": "stuff"
    },

    {
      "@type": "dataset",
      "@id": "http://global_unique_id",
      "name": "Species name"
    }
  ]
}'

jsonld_flatten(ex, context)
## {
##   "@context": {
##     "@vocab": "http://example.com/"
##   },
##   "@graph": [
##     {
##       "@id": "_:b0",
##       "datasets": {
##         "@id": "http://global_unique_id"
##       }
##     },
##     {
##       "@id": "http://global_unique_id",
##       "@type": "dataset",
##       "image": "http://image_uri",
##       "name": [
##         "stuff",
##         "Species name"
##       ]
##     }
##   ]
## }
